Black Lightning - Season 2

Season 2

Episodes

The Book of Consequences: Chapter One: Rise of the Green Light Babies
Months after the ASA's attack, Jeff and his family discover that things are worse than ever. Green Light babies are rampant in the street, the board is threatening to shut down Garfield, an ASA agent is probing into Lynn's involvement with the pods, and Anissa's powers are going out of control.

The Book of Consequences: Chapter Two: Black Jesus Blues
One of the Green Light Babies escapes her pod and goes on a rampage. Meanwhile, Jeff is informed that he has been replaced as principal, Anissa reconnects with Grace, and Khalil pays Jennifer a visit.

The Book of Consequences: Chapter Three: Master Lowry
Jeff cleans out his desk after the board retires him as principal. Meanwhile, Anissa goes looking for money to keep Holt's clinic from going insolvent, Lynn gets a new co-worker, and Jennifer meets a woman with a unique gift.

The Book of Consequences: Chapter Four: Translucent Freak
While Tobias scheme to clear himself of any suspicion of Alvin's death, Jeff has it out with Anissa, Jennifer, Bill, and Lowry.

The Book of Blood: Chapter One: Requiem
Death strikes close to home for the Pierce family, and Jeff has trouble coping. Jace offers Lynn a solution to saving the Green Light babies, and a new threat emerges in South Freeland.

The Book of Blood: Chapter Two: The Perdi
While Lynn deals with the aftermath of fourteen deaths, Anissa meets with Anaya's parents and help her deliver her baby... only to receive a surprise.

The Book of Blood: Chapter Three: The Sange
Looker and her Sange search for Anaya's after electrocuting a captive Jeff. Their mistake. Meanwhile, Jennifer and Khalil come up with a short-term plan to get Holt out of harm's way, but Holt isn't interested in cooperating.

The Book of Rebellion: Chapter One: Exodus
Jeff reveals to Lynn and Anissa that Peter is still alive, and together they go searching for Jennifer and Khalil. Meanwhile, Tobias brings in an old "friend" to hunt down Khalil, who catches up to Khalil at the same time that Black Lightning does.

The Book of Rebellion: Chapter Two: Gift of the Magi
Jennifer breaks into a hospital supply room to get the antibiotics she needs for Khalil when he becomes feverish from his injury. While Cutter tracks her, Black Lightning, Thunder, and Peter try to find the missing teenagers while Lynn approaches Khalil's estranged father.

The Book of Rebellion: Chapter Three: Angelitos Negros
Jennifer decides that it's time to stop running, and Jeff asks Bill for a favor. Tobias reveals to Todd why he's supporting him financially, and Todd learns of a secret that is the key to Tobias controlling Freeland.

The Book of Secrets: Chapter One: Prodigal Son
While the Pierces gather around a dying Khalil, Tobias discovers that Jace knows where the Masters of Disasters are and breaks her out of ASA custody.

The Book of Secrets: Chapter Two: Just and Unjust
Jennifer grieves in the aftermath of Khalil's death, and Odell saves Lynn from an abduction. At Garfield, Jennifer and Jeff both confront Lowry, while Anissa is surprised by a sudden turn of events with Grace.

The Book of Secrets: Chapter Three: Pillar of Fire
Tobias activates one of the Masters of Disaster, and sends him and Cutter to bring him the other pods. Napier gets Jeff a chance to get his old job back, and Anissa learns more about Grace's history.

The Book of Secrets: Chapter Four: Original Sin
Jeff receives a visit from a former student, Anissa goes looking for Grace, and Jennifer gets a new suit.

The Book of the Apocalypse: Chapter One: The Alpha
Tobias initiates the first step in selling his army of metas, Jeff sets down some ground rules to his daughters, and Lala and Lazarus have a chat.

The Book of the Apocalypse: Chapter Two: The Omega
Black Lightning and Thunder take on the Masters of Disaster, while Peter and Jennifer try to restore the city's power during the riots that break out after Cape Guy's death. Tobias and Cutter have a disagreement, and Odell makes his move.

48 Hours
48 Hours is a CBS news magazine that investigates intriguing crime and justice cases that touch on all aspects of the human experience. Over its long run, the show has helped exonerate wrongly convicted people, driven the reopening -- and resolution -- of cold cases, and changed numerous lives. CBS News correspondents offer an in-depth look into each story, with the emphasis on solving the mystery at its heart. The program and its team have earned critical acclaim, including 20 Emmys and three Peabody Awards.
